This is the first comprehensive review of the rapidly emerging computer-assisted technologies that are starting to fundamentally influence the way that we design, plan, simulate, and carry out orthopedic surgery. This well-illustrated volume provides an overview of the state-of-the-art of the development of CAOS, and its clinical applications. Topics covered range from basic concepts to planning, simulation and execution of surgery in different anatomical areas, including the spine, hip and knee. Various surgical techniques, such as joint reconstruction and replacement, trauma fixation, and minimally invasive approaches are also presented.
